Fix various issues when the engine disconnects:
Previously Port::PortDrop was never handled. The signal was disconnected directly when the connection is re-used by Port::PortSignalDrop. Ports::drop() was not called when the engine was stopped or disconnected, and port-handles were not invalidated. This lead to crashes whenever a port-related operation was performed while the engine was stopped. e.g. adding/removing tracks or plugins (latency recompute, notify port-engine) and various other operations.
